Express Glazed Donuts
These delicious donuts taste like scratch made, but they come from a roll of biscuit dough. We call them express because the come together quickly. Perfect for a weekend brunch. This recipe will have everyone thinking you went to a lot of trouble to make these.

Ingredients
- 1 Can of Biscuits ready to bake
- 5 Cups Vegetable Oil for frying
- 2 ¼ Cups Confectioners Sugar
- 1 Teaspoon Vanilla Extract
- 5 Tablespoons Milk
Instructions
- Heat the oil to reach 375 degrees F and hold at this temperature.
- To form your donut take the biscuits and place on a flat surface, punch a hole in the middle (I use a shot glass). Make sure to keep the middle to make donut holes!
- Mix your glaze up by combining the confectioners’ sugar, milk, and vanilla until smooth.
- Place 2-3 donuts in the hot oil at a time (don’t overcrowd the oil) cook for one minute then flip and cook for another minute.
- Remove the donut from the oil and let it drain on a wire rack for 1 minute (don’t let donuts cool).
- Place donuts into sugar glaze and submerge, then remove, let drip and place back on wire rack to dry and cool.

Notes
In the picture, I also created a little sugar and cinnamon mixture and dipped the donuts in a few just for a different taste and it was just as good!!
